S.A.W., the collaborative project of ex-Tangerine Dream member Johannes Schmoelling and renowned sound design luminary Kurt Ader, presents their second album, “Hydragate.” This compelling release combines elements of ambient, electronica, and cinematic sound collages, weaving a tapestry of emotions across its 10 tracks. From epic power to lightness, S.A.W. effortlessly navigates different emotional energies, captivating listeners with their musical prowess.
Throughout “Hydragate,” the four musicians traverse a sonic landscape that encompasses both familiar and uncharted territory. Tracks like “Surface Illusions” and “Hydragate” showcase the composed melody lines reminiscent of Johannes Schmoelling’s work during his time with Tangerine Dream. These pieces evoke a sense of familiarity for fans of electronic-rock legends while adding a fresh twist to the sound.
On “Whispering Colours,” S.A.W. demonstrates their dexterity in programming sequences that transport listeners into a trance-like world. The intricate sound design, a result of Kurt Ader’s expertise as a sound designer for renowned synthesizer manufacturers and collaborations with artists like Nightwish, Dream Theater, and Michael Cretu, adds depth and texture to the compositions.
“S.A.W. also explores filigree sound design on ‘Sphere,’ creating an immersive sonic experience. The album’s diversity shines through on ‘Inside Out,’ where alienated ethnic sounds blend seamlessly with the dark ambient soundscapes of the present. “Master of Time” pays homage to the electronic music of the 1970s while infusing it with a contemporary edge.
In addition to their atmospheric and melodic compositions, S.A.W. offers rhythmic tracks that add a dynamic element to the album. “Distant Memories” and “Stop And Go” showcase their ability to create captivating rhythms that propel the listener forward.
“Hydragate” was meticulously developed and recorded in various studios across Munich, Berlin, Mannheim, and Hitzacker. The album’s production involved the use of various samples, analog drum machines, modular and digital synthesizers, resulting in a rich and immersive sonic landscape.
